discrete

/dɪsˈkɹiːt/
adjective
  1. Separate; distinct; individual; non-continuous.

    "a government with three discrete divisions"

  2. That can be perceived individually and not as connected to, or part of something else.

  3. Having separate electronic components, such as individual diodes, transistors and resisters, as opposed to integrated circuitry.

Antonymsmultiplexed, integrated, continuous
